首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

POM错误:在https://repo.maven.apache.org/maven2中找不到com.redhat.quarkus:quarkus-universe-bom:pom:1.3.2.Final-redhat-00001

POM错误是指在使用Maven构建项目时,无法在指定的Maven仓库中找到所需的依赖项。具体到这个错误,是因为在https://repo.maven.apache.org/maven2中找不到com.redhat.quarkus:quarkus-universe-bom:pom:1.3.2.Final-redhat-00001。

POM(Project Object Model)是Maven项目的核心文件,它描述了项目的基本信息、依赖关系、构建配置等。在Maven构建过程中,会根据POM文件中的依赖配置从Maven仓库中下载所需的依赖项。然而,如果指定的依赖项在仓库中不存在,就会出现POM错误。

针对这个错误,可以采取以下几个步骤进行排查和解决:

  1. 检查网络连接:首先确保网络连接正常,能够访问https://repo.maven.apache.org/maven2。如果网络存在问题,可能导致无法从仓库中下载依赖项。
  2. 检查依赖配置:确认POM文件中是否正确配置了com.redhat.quarkus:quarkus-universe-bom:pom:1.3.2.Final-redhat-00001作为依赖项。可以检查POM文件中的<dependencies>标签下是否包含了正确的依赖配置。
  3. 检查仓库配置:确认Maven的配置文件(settings.xml)中是否正确配置了Maven仓库的地址。可以检查<repositories>标签下是否包含了正确的仓库配置。
  4. 检查依赖项是否存在其他仓库:有时候某些依赖项可能不在默认的Maven仓库中,而是存在于其他第三方仓库中。可以尝试在POM文件中添加其他仓库的配置,以便能够找到所需的依赖项。
  5. 检查依赖项的版本:确认所需的依赖项版本号是否正确。有时候指定的版本号可能不存在于仓库中,需要根据实际情况进行调整。

对于Quarkus Universe BOM(Bill of Materials),它是一个用于管理Quarkus项目依赖项版本的POM文件。Quarkus是一种开发Java应用程序的框架,旨在提供快速启动时间和低内存消耗。Quarkus Universe BOM可以帮助开发者管理Quarkus项目的依赖项,确保它们的版本兼容性。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云容器服务(Tencent Kubernetes Engine,TKE):https://cloud.tencent.com/product/tke
  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云对象存储(Cloud Object Storage,COS):https://cloud.tencent.com/product/cos
  • 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/cdb
  • 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
  • 腾讯云物联网(IoT):https://cloud.tencent.com/product/iot
  • 腾讯云移动开发(Mobile Development):https://cloud.tencent.com/product/md
  • 腾讯云区块链(Blockchain):https://cloud.tencent.com/product/bc
  • 腾讯云元宇宙(Metaverse):https://cloud.tencent.com/product/mv
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的文章

领券